What does it cost to fully upgrade a home in Lakewood, NJ? (2026)

Lakewood · full-home upgrade
$31,700 $79,600

A localized estimate to bring a typical Lakewood home's major systems up to date.

If you're mapping out a full modernization in Lakewood, here's how the pieces add up — localized 2026 estimates for each major project, with a full breakdown one click away.

ProjectLakewood 2026 range
HVACFurnace Replacement$4,050 $7,250
RoofingAsphalt Shingle Roof Replacement$6,000 $12,350
Water HeatersTank Water Heater Replacement$1,250 $3,250
WindowsVinyl Window Replacement$5,150 $15,200
PaintingInterior House Painting$4,050 $12,100
FlooringHardwood Flooring Installation$6,050 $15,100
PlumbingWhole House Repipe$3,650 $8,300
InsulationAttic Insulation$1,500 $6,050
Complete home upgrade$31,700 $79,600

Renovating a home in Lakewood

How much does it cost to fully renovate a home in Lakewood?

Lakewood homeowners tackling a full renovation should budget $31,700–$79,600 in 2026, covering one representative project per major category, localized for local labor, climate and permits.

Which home upgrade is most expensive in Lakewood?

Hardwood Flooring Installation runs highest at $6,050–$15,100, with Tank Water Heater Replacement the lightest lift at $1,250–$3,250.

Should I do every upgrade at once in Lakewood?

Most homeowners don't do it all in one go. Start with the systems that are failing or matter most — in Lakewood, that's often flooring — then spread the remaining projects over several years to avoid one disruptive, expensive stretch.
